On 06 April 2026, the Deputy Secretary of War officially established the Economic Defense Unit. The EDU Director is the principal advisor to the Deputy Secretary of War for Economic Competition across the Department. The EDU will lead, advise, coordinate, synchronize, analyze and assess economic competition across the DoW.
The Executive Secretariat SME provides operational support within the Secretary of the Office of Secretary of War, Economic Defense Unit (OSW EDU) playing a pivotal role in developing and implementing key standards across all formal correspondence and documentation associated with OSW EDU on behalf of key stakeholders and Senior leadership. This position is responsible for fostering effective communication and coordination with directorates, programs, stakeholders within and external to OSW EDU to ensure the successful execution of Senior Executive engagements and activities.
Per PWS section 1.3.10.5 Executive Secretariat Support, specific responsibilities include but are not limited to:
- The contractor shall provide correspondence control and management; tasking and tracking management, and related Executive Secretariat administrative support to include coordinating the internal work of the organization, serve as the liaison between the organization, higher headquarters, and outside agencies. The contractor shall employ expert advice for correspondence management and ensure adherence to updates pertaining to policies and procedures for the preparation and managing of correspondence.
Employ editing, proofing, revising skills, agility in addressing competing priorities, matters of protocol and engagements with senior leadership. The contractor shall also perform the following duties: - Ensure correspondence adherence to standards of quality and consistency with DoW/EDU precedents and policies.
- Initiate, monitor, and coordinate completion of ADMIN branch tasks through EDU’s task management tools.
- Manage EDU correspondence. This includes tracking EDU’s action items; preparing statuses of actions; keeping metrics; providing briefing charts of statuses/metrics as required.
- Review EDU correspondence for non-functional content edits. This includes addressing management, policy and procedures to include formatting and grammatical edits, and proper correspondence packaging in accordance with DoW manuals, Instructions, Administrative Instructions, and other correspondence processes such as, but not limited to, preparation and tracking of SECDEF Form 391 Correspondence Action Report for taskings.
- Employ expertise and subject knowledge regarding correspondence management, including familiarity with applicable DoW directives and guidance, Intelligence Community correspondence policies and procedures, and utilization of automated systems for correspondence currently in use.
- Utilize the EDU determined tasking management system (TMT or any subsequent systems) to provide tasking management support.
